SUNY Polytechnic Institute and Metro450, an Israeli consortium of companies and universities, will invest $2.9 million to develop standard calibration wafers.

Metro450 will commit $1.6 million to develop and produce standard calibration wafers to use with 300mm and 450mm tools. SUNY Polytechnic will commit $1.3 million in products, services and tool time. The semiconductor industry is transitioning to 450mm wafer technology.
